RBG Strategy and Communication
Blitz RBG is fundamentally about focus fire and chain CCs. Unlike arena where you're split up, RBG is grouped warfare.
Call Priority Targets. The team needs to focus on one target at a time. If you can't kill fast, you lose. Assign a raid leader (usually healer or UI person) to call targets and CCs. Everyone else tunnels that target until death.
Chain CCs into Kills. Before bursting a target, chain your hard CCs. Rogue stuns, Mage polymorphs, Monk legues enemy, Druid roots. One stun locks the target for 5+ seconds while you unload damage. No one escapes.
Protect Your Healer. Your healers are priority #1. If an enemy Rogue opens your healer, melee DPS need to peel and CC the attacker. A dead healer means a lost fight. Rotate defensively around the healer.
Play the Objective. Kill enemies on the objective point, not across the map. Games are short; you don't have time to chase stragglers. Group up, win the teamfight on objective, cap the flag or defend the point.
Coordinate Cooldowns. Don't blow your big defensives when enemies have no offensive cooldowns ready. Ask in comms: "Does anyone have defensives?" Before you commit to a kill, burn their big shields first (priest shields, druid ironbark). Then burst when they're vulnerable.
Position Spread. Don't stack in one spot or an AoE ability wipes you. Spread at arm's length. Spread wide enough to avoid cleave, but tight enough to protect each other from gaps.

Tips for Climbing RBG Rating
Find a Consistent Team. Solo queue works, but a consistent 5-8 player roster climbs faster. You learn each other's playstyles, trust each other's CCs, and minimize communication delays. Recruit guildmates or friends and lock a roster.
Play the Meta Specs. RBG is less forgiving of off-meta picks than arena. If you're climbing to 2.1K, play Balance Druid, not Shadow Priest. Play the specs that work, then innovate once you're rating-capped.
One Person Calls Targets. Too many voices kill coordination. Designate one shotcaller (usually a healer) who calls targets and CCs. Everyone else shuts up and executes. This single change skyrockets winrate.
Play for Momentum. Win streaks happen. After three wins in a row, keep playing. Momentum is real in RBG. After two losses, take a break. Tilt kills rating faster than anything.
Analyze Losses. Did you lose because of bad play, bad comps, or unlucky teamups? If it's bad play, identify the mistake. If it's comps, swap players around. If it's luck, move on. Don't blame teammates; focus on what you control.
Farm Conquest Early. The sooner you hit 2.1K, the longer you have to farm conquest and prepare for Gladiator push. Early-season Heroes set themselves up for success in rating at the end of the season.
